		<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>I wanted to put the Celtics in as a potential challenger to the Heat, but in the playoffs, Rajon Rondo was always the guy who *killed* the Heat.</p>
<p>Especially in last year&#8217;s playoff series, Rondo versus the Heat&#8217;s point guards (Chalmers/Cole) was the Celtics&#8217; biggest mismatch.</p>
<p>So while the Celtics did beat the Heat without Rondo a couple of weeks ago, I really don&#8217;t think the Celtics can beat the Heat in a 7-game series (with the Heat having home-court advantage) without Rondo. It&#8217;s also important to remember that after that game, the Celtics lost Jared Sullinger (who had started playing really well recently and hurts their big-man rotation) and Barbosa (which has left them with very little guard depth) for the rest of the season.</p>

		<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Disagreed.</p>
<p>There are a few teams in each conference who pose threats to the Heat. I&#8217;m not saying I&#8217;d bet against the Heat if they played against these teams, but I wouldn&#8217;t be *shocked* if they did beat the Heat in a 7-game series, the way I&#8217;d be shocked if, say, the Bucks beat the Heat:</p>
<p>In the East &#8211; Bulls (if Rose comes back), Pacers (if Danny Granger is back at full-health), and Knicks (if they&#8217;re hitting their 3&#8242;s)</p>
<p>In the West &#8211; OKC (if they stop resorting to iso-ball on offense so much), Clippers (good athleticism and depth), and Spurs (the best way to beat the Heat&#8217;s aggressive defense is with excellent passing, which is the Spurs&#8217; specialty)</p>
